Understanding Smart Warehousing

Smart Warehousing refers to the use of automation, Internet of Things (IoT) devices, artificial intelligence (AI), and robotics to optimize warehouse operations. These technologies enable real-time data collection, predictive analytics, and seamless integration across supply chains, leading to faster and more accurate fulfillment processes.

Factors Driving Demand

The Smart Warehousing demand is propelled by several key factors:

  • E-commerce Growth: The surge in online shopping has increased the need for efficient order processing and rapid delivery times.

  • Labor Shortages: Automation helps mitigate the challenges posed by workforce limitations, ensuring consistent operations.

  • Cost Reduction: Implementing smart technologies can lead to significant savings by minimizing errors and optimizing resource utilization.

In-Depth Market Analysis

An Smart Warehousing analysis reveals that the sector is witnessing a shift towards integrated systems that combine hardware, software, and services. Key components include:

  • Automation Tools: Such as robotic arms and automated guided vehicles (AGVs) that streamline material handling.

  • Data Analytics Platforms: Offering insights into inventory levels, demand forecasting, and performance metrics.

  • Cloud-Based Solutions: Facilitating real-time data access and collaboration across global supply chains.
